7 Essential Tips for Buying Funko Pop Collectibles

  1. Research the figures you want: Before making a purchase, do some research on the Funko Pop figures you're interested in. Check out reviews, images, and videos to get a better sense of what the figure looks like and if it's worth the price.

  2. Be aware of rarity: Some Funko Pops are more rare than others, which can make them more valuable and harder to find. Consider this when making your purchase, as it can affect the price and availability.

  3. Check for authenticity: Make sure the Funko Pop figure you're buying is authentic. Look for official licensing information, check the packaging for signs of tampering or damage, and make sure the seller has good ratings and reviews.

  4. Consider the condition: If you're a serious collector, the condition of the Funko Pop figure is important. Check for any damage, such as dents, scratches, or paint flaws, and ask the seller for detailed images if necessary.

  5. Shop around: Don't settle for the first seller you come across. Shop around to compare prices and availability, and check multiple sources such as online marketplaces, local stores, and conventions.

  6. Don't overpay: While some Funko Pops can be quite valuable, it's important to avoid overpaying for a figure. Set a budget for yourself and stick to it, and don't let FOMO (fear of missing out) drive up the price.

  7. Have fun: Collecting Funko Pops should be a fun and enjoyable hobby. Don't stress too much about finding the perfect figure, and remember that it's all about the joy of collecting and displaying these awesome little figures.
